Reference by name OR GUID in data pipelines

When trying to set up a dynamic data pipeline you currently have the option to use IDs, however this means that there is some admin involved when you want to deploy a pipeline from dev->test->prod in that you have to manually change the IDs for the specific environment. If we could use the name of the workspace/notebook/object/stored proc etc from a drop down list or manually instead that would make it a lot easier to make new deployments and save us from having to find all the IDs etc.
